Getting a handle on your budget doesn't have to be intimidating! One of the fundamental steps is understanding the concept of a budget line. Think of it as a limit you set for a particular expense, like groceries. You decide how much cash you’re willing to spend each week. For example, you might establish a budget line of $80 for eating out. Reviewing your spending within that range helps you stay on track. It's a simple yet valuable technique for gaining control your financial life.
Knowing Your Spending Budget Limit
A clear understanding of your budget line is absolutely crucial for obtaining your financial goals. Your budget line represents the maximum amount you’re willing to spend in a particular department, like groceries, leisure or transportation. Periodically reviewing this line helps you identify areas where you might be going over or where you could potentially reduce your expenses. Think of it as a limit keeping you on the appropriate track toward stability. Don’t just set a limit; actively monitor it and adjust as needed to align with your changing situations.

Breaking Your Budgetary Limit
It's a common occurrence: you're diligently tracking your outlays, sticking to your meticulously planned budget, and then…suddenly costs arise. Whether it's an urgent urgent bill, a required home repair, or an irresistible chance that presents itself, breaking your budget line can feel overwhelming. Don't immediately panic; assessing the situation is key. Perhaps you need to re-evaluate your current allocations, briefly dip into savings, or seek alternative earnings streams. It’s vital to keep in mind that occasional overspending doesn't always signify financial disaster, but instead a indication to re-assess your entire financial plan.
